This is a still life painting of a pheasant with its tail emerging from a decorative, porcelain teapot. The pheasant's tail is fanned out and exhibits a rich palette of browns, golds, and greens. The teapot is primarily white with a light blue, vertical ribbed texture. It is adorned with small, colorful floral patterns and has a delicate, gold-trimmed handle and spout. The background is a plain, light beige, suggesting a studio setting or a neutral backdrop to emphasize the main subjects. The artwork appears to be rendered in oil paints, with visible brushstrokes contributing to the texture and depth of the forms. There are no people, text, or discernible environmental cues like time of day or weather. The focus is solely on the unusual juxtaposition of the dead bird and the ornate teapot.
